Sleep disturbance might sound like a bad thing for improvising, since responding and sharpness are an important factor. But it doesn't have to be. It can change perspectives, as if you're putting on a different lens. Lärmschutz has a somewhat ambiguous relation to sleep, since one member often sleeps for only short durations of time and the other has a history of nightmares.


Lärmschutz consists of a core duo, Stef Brans and Rutger van Driel, aided here by drummer Thanos Fotiadis. One night, after a gig, Stef and Rutger measured their sleep using a phone app. The outcome was a deep sleep for one, and a restless dream sleep for the other. The graph chart from those nocturnal hours were translated into a graphic chart for improvisation.


Sleepcycles is the result of these improvisations. A coming to terms with their own sleeping patterns.
